Georgia Music Educators Association Choral Division Renee Wilson-Wicker, Chair

2009 Georgia All-State Reading Chorus Constantina Tsolainou, Conductor Chris Fowler, Accompanist Chris McMichen, Organizer Saturday, January 31st 11:00am Savannah Trade Center / Rooms 200-202 Sponsored by J.W. Pepper & Sons Constantina Tsolainou Constantina Tsolainou, the Paul S. and Jean R. Amos Chair in Conducting and Director of Choral Activities in the Schwob School of Music at Columbus State University, has held conducting positions at Southern Methodist University, Westminster Choir College, New England Conservatory, McGill University (Montreal, Quebec), Oregon State University, and Oklahoma City University. Ms. Tsolainou has also served as Artistic Director of the Canterbury Choral Society (Oklahoma City), Director of Music at Lovers Lane United Methodist Church, and Artistic Director of the Aria Chamber Chorus (Dallas, Texas). During her tenure at SMU, Ms. Tsolainou established the SMU/Dallas Vocal Arts Ensemble; while in Montreal she was the Artistic Director and Conductor of Anima Musica, an ensemble formerly known in Canada as the Donovan Chorale. She is currently Principal Guest Conductor of the Arts District Chorale (Dallas, Texas). Ms. Tsolainou has presented workshops, master classes and concert performances in Australia, Canada, China, Europe, and throughout the U.S. In collaboration with James Jordan of Westminster Choir College, she developed the instructional video Ensemble Diction: Language and Style, Principles and Application, and participated in a second video entitled Group Vocal Technique: The Choral Ensemble Warm-up. Trained first as a singer, Ms. Tsolainou has appeared in opera and musical theatre productions in addition to numerous performances on the concert stage. Conductors with whom she has worked include Leonard Bernstein, Charles Dutoit, Eric Ericson, Joseph Flummerfelt, Carlo Maria Giulini, Zubin Mehta, Riccardo Muti and Robert Shaw.

Chris Fowler Chris Fowler is the Choral Music Director at Buford High School and the Fine Arts Coordinator for the Buford City School System. He holds the Bachelor and Master of Music degrees from Georgia State University. Mr. Fowler is presently pursuing the Doctor of Musical Arts degree (ABD) at the University of Georgia. Mr. Fowler is an active performer in many musical styles. He has been a clinician at numerous honor choruses and festivals. His conducting experience includes work with collegiate ensembles and adult community groups. Singers under Mr. Fowler's direction have performed at the Georgia Music Educators state convention and at Carnegie Hall. He has served as a frequent accompanist to district honor choruses and he will serve as the accompanist to the Georgia All State Chorus for the fourteenth time this year. He has served as staff accompanist to many churches in the Atlanta area. He resides in Suwanee with his wife, Joy, and his children, Alex and Hope.
